Presentation is loading. Please wait.

Presentation is loading. Please wait.

DiffServ QoS model (RMD) A. Bader, G. Karagiannis.

Similar presentations


Presentation on theme: "DiffServ QoS model (RMD) A. Bader, G. Karagiannis."— Presentation transcript:

1 DiffServ QoS model (RMD) A. Bader, G. Karagiannis

2 Current DiffServ Traffic differentiation Admission/policy control at the borders, simpler functions in the interior nodes No QoS signaling within the domain RMD QoS signaling within the DiffServ domain and can be extended to multi-domain Provides dynamic QoS support, better link utilization Scalable (complexity at edge, simple in interiors)

3 DiffServ QoS signaling model RMD in NSIS Edge Interior Edge DiffServ domain Interior: No per flow states: only per PHB states and no NTLP states Local QSpec: bandwidth + control flags Per flow NTLP and NSLP states QSpec: token bucket or more complex descriptors End Per flow NTLP and NSLP states

4 Reduced state operation model of NSIS IP QoS- NSLP E2E QoS model NTLP User application IP NTLP IP NTLP/D-mode IP NTLP IP NTLP User application Initiator Receiver Edge Interior E2E QoS model Local-QoS E2E QoS model Local-QoS NTLP and NSLP per- flow states NTLP stateless per- class or no NSLP states QoS- NSLP NTLP and NSLP per- flow states NTLP and NSLP per- flow states NTLP and NSLP per- flow states

5 RMD QSpec Bandwidth or number of resource units Additional control information (fields and flags) as a consequence of the stateless operation: TTL, M, S, etc. Question: Should we continue working on RMD model as a WG draft towards inf. or exp. RFC?

6 Successful reservation Initiator ReceiverEdge Interior Resv(QSpec) Resv(E2E ignore, QSpec) Resv(QSpec) Resv(LQSpec) Response

7 Failed reservation Initiator ReceiverEdge Interior Resv(QSpec) Resv(E2E ignore, QSpec) Resv(LQSpec) Resv(LQSpec:M-marked) Response: Congestion rep. Response Resv(LQSpec:M-marked) Unsuccesful resv. Resv(Tear) Resv(Tear, TTL=1)

8 Severe congestion handling by data marking Initiator ReceiverEdge Interior User Data Data: S-marked Resv(Tear) Response: Congestion rep. Severe congestion Resv(Tear)

9 Aggregation types RSVP aggregation-like –topology dependent (aggregation of flows between aggregation points) –aggregation per DSCP –statefull nodes –aggregated refreshes RMD-like –topology independent, aggregation per DSCP only –statefull edges, stateless interior –per flow refreshes Combination of the two types


Download ppt "DiffServ QoS model (RMD) A. Bader, G. Karagiannis."

Similar presentations


Ads by Google